The Summer Conference for Computer Studies Educators hosted by the Centre for Education in Mathematics and Computing (CEMC) provides resources for educators to implement the computer science and computer engineering curriculum in their classrooms. Every August, participants spend three days networking with other educators, learning new skills and brainstorming classroom activity ideas.
This three-day residential conference is designed for high school computer studies educators. However, interested elementary school educators are welcome to attend.
The conference will be held in person at the University of Waterloo from August 13 to August 15, 2024. Participants can arrive on campus on the evening of Monday, August 12 or between 7:30 a.m. and 8:30 a.m. on Tuesday, August 13.
Sessions start at 9:00 a.m. on Tuesday and the conference ends with lunch on Thursday. Note the different start time from previous conferences.

The registration fee is $250 for each participant. This includes any applicable taxes, meals and accommodation. The conference fee remains the same for everyone regardless of whether they choose to stay in the accommodation provided.
